Abstract

A self-service checkout device, method, apparatus, medium and electronic device, the self-service checkout method comprising: identifying whether an item to be checked out is an item of a target type when the item to be checked out is placed in a checkout area (S402); if the item to be checked out is an item of the target type, then identifying the quantity of the item to be checked out, acquiring the unit price of the item to be checked out, and generating checkout information according to the quantity and the unit price of the item to be checked out (S404); if the item to be checked out is not an item of the target type, then identifying the category of the item to be checked out, acquiring the weight of the item to be checked out, and generating checkout information according to the category and the weight of the item to be checked out (S406). The present technical solution improves the range of application of self-service checkout and is beneficial in improving the self-service checkout experience of users.

背景技术Background technique
传统的线下零售通常采用有人收银台的模式进行结算,主要包括收银员扫码、出票、付款等流程。在这种方案中,一个收银台需要一个收银员,人力成本较高。随着新零售概念的提出,市面上目前出现了自助结算机,这种自助结算机需要顾客自己操作扫码枪扫描商品背面的条形码,虽然解放了收银员,降低了人力成本,但扫码对顾客操作熟练程度要求偏高,影响了自助结算的效率。同时,顾客自助扫码只适用于标准品的结算,而对于非标准品,如水果、蔬菜等需要称重结算的商品并不支持。Traditional offline retailing is usually settled by a cashier model, which mainly includes cashier scanning, ticketing, payment and other processes. In this scenario, a cashier needs a cashier and the labor costs are higher. With the introduction of the new retail concept, there is a self-service settlement machine on the market. This self-service settlement machine requires the customer to operate the scan code gun to scan the barcode on the back of the product. Although the cashier is liberated and the labor cost is reduced, the scan code pair The customer's operational proficiency requirements are high, which affects the efficiency of self-checkout. At the same time, the customer self-scanning code is only applicable to the settlement of standard products, but it is not supported for non-standard products such as fruits and vegetables that need to be weighed and settled.
因此,如何能够提高自助结算的适用范围,进而提升用户的自助结算体验成为亟待解决的技术问题。Therefore, how to improve the scope of self-checkout and improve the self-service settlement experience of users has become a technical problem to be solved.

在介绍了本发明实施例的自助结算设备的结构之后,以下对本发明实施例的自助结算方法进行阐述。After the structure of the self-checkout device of the embodiment of the present invention is introduced, the self-checkout method of the embodiment of the present invention will be described below.
图4示意性示出了根据本发明的实施例的自助结算方法的流程图,该自助结算方法可以应用于上述实施例中所述的自助结算设备。4 is a flow chart schematically showing a self-checkout method according to an embodiment of the present invention, which can be applied to the self-checkout device described in the above embodiment.
参照图4所示,根据本发明的实施例的自助结算方法,包括:Referring to FIG. 4, a self-checkout method according to an embodiment of the present invention includes:
步骤S402,在待结算商品放置在结算区域时,识别所述待结算商品是否为目标类型的商品。Step S402, when the item to be settled is placed in the settlement area, it is identified whether the item to be settled is an item of the target type.
在本发明的实施例中,目标类型的商品是不需要进行称重即可进行结算的商品,比如已经包装好的具有条码或射频标签的标准品等。In the embodiment of the present invention, the target type of goods is an item that can be settled without weighing, such as a packaged standard having a bar code or a radio frequency tag.
对于识别待结算商品是否为目标类型的商品,本发明提出了如下几种识别方案:The present invention proposes the following identification schemes for identifying whether the goods to be settled are of a target type:
识别方案一:Identification scheme one:
判断通过射频识别器是否能够识别到所述待结算商品的信息;若通过射频识别器能够识别到所述待结算商品的信息,则确定所述待结算商品为所述目标类型的商品。Determining whether the information of the commodity to be settled can be recognized by the radio frequency identifier; if the information of the commodity to be settled can be identified by the radio frequency identifier, determining that the commodity to be settled is the commodity of the target type.
在识别方案一中需要在商品上设置射频标签,这样能够通过射频识别器识别待结算商品是否为目标类型的商品。In the identification scheme 1, it is necessary to set a radio frequency tag on the commodity, so that the RFID reader can be used to identify whether the commodity to be settled is a target type of commodity.
识别方案二:Identification scheme two:
判断通过条码识别器是否能够识别到所述待结算商品的信息;若通过条码识别器能够识别到所述待结算商品的信息,则确定所述待结算商品为所述目标类型的商品。Determining whether the information of the item to be settled can be recognized by the barcode identifier; if the information of the item to be settled can be identified by the barcode identifier, determining that the item to be settled is the item of the target type.
识别方案三:Identification scheme three:
通过图像采集设备采集包含所述待结算商品的图像;根据所述图像识别所述待结算商品的种类;根据识别到的种类,确定所述待结算商品是否为所述目标类型的商品。Collecting, by the image collecting device, an image including the item to be settled; identifying the type of the item to be settled according to the image; and determining, according to the identified type, whether the item to be settled is the item of the target type.
对于识别方案三,参照图5所示,根据所述图像识别所述待结算商品的种类,包括以下步骤:For the identification scheme 3, referring to FIG. 5, identifying the type of the commodity to be settled according to the image includes the following steps:
步骤S501,基于目标检测技术识别所述图像中的商品信息。Step S501, identifying the commodity information in the image based on the target detection technology.
在本发明的实施例中,目标检测技术需要构建相应的距离函数来捕获相应的特征来进行检测。例如如果目标是识别人脸,那么就需要构建一个距离函数去强化合适的特征(如发色,脸型等);而如果目标是识别姿势,那么就需要构建一个捕获姿势相似度的距离函数。为了处理各种各样的特征相似度,可以针对特定的任务通过选择合适的特征并手动构建距离函数。然而这种方法需要很大的人工投入,并且也会出现对数据的改变适应性不强的问题。因此本发明的实施例采用了度量学习的方案作为替代,以根据不同的任务来自主学习出针对某个特定任务的度量距离函数。In an embodiment of the invention, the target detection technique requires the construction of a corresponding distance function to capture the corresponding features for detection. For example, if the goal is to recognize a human face, then you need to construct a distance function to enhance the appropriate features (such as hair color, face, etc.); and if the target is to recognize the gesture, then you need to construct a distance function that captures the similarity of the pose. To handle a wide variety of feature similarities, the distance function can be manually constructed by selecting the appropriate features for a particular task. However, this method requires a lot of manual input, and there is also a problem that the adaptability to the data change is not strong. Thus, embodiments of the present invention employ a metric learning alternative as an alternative to learning the metric distance function for a particular task from the master based on different tasks.
需要说明的是:度量学习(Metric Learning)就是常说的相似度学习。如果需要计算两张图片之间的相似度,如何度量图片之间的相似度使得不同类别的图片相似度小而相同类别的图片相似度大(maximize the inter-class variations and minimize the intra-class variations)就是度量学习的目标。It should be noted that Metric Learning is the similarity learning that is often said. If it is necessary to calculate the similarity between two pictures, how to measure the similarity between the pictures is such that the similarity of the pictures of different categories is small and the pictures of the same category are similar (maximize the inter-class variations and minimize the intra-class variations ) is to measure the goal of learning.
在本发明的实施例中,可以采用Faster-RCNN进行商品检测,Faster-RCNN是一种由RPN(Region Proposal Network)和RCNN(Region CNN)组成,RPN输出可能是感兴趣物体的位置和大小,RCNN对每一个候选位置进行分类。RPN和RCNN本质上均是卷积神经网络(Convolutional Neural Network,CNN),但两者共享了特征抽取层,因此Faster-RCNN执行效率高,在GPU(Graphics Processing Unit,图形处理器)的帮助下,可以做到实时。In the embodiment of the present invention, the Faster-RCNN may be used for commodity detection, and the Faster-RCNN is composed of an RPN (Region Proposal Network) and an RCNN (Region CNN), and the RPN output may be the position and size of the object of interest. The RCNN classifies each candidate location. RPN and RCNN are essentially Convolutional Neural Network (CNN), but they share the feature extraction layer, so Faster-RCNN is highly efficient, with the help of GPU (Graphics Processing Unit). Can do it in real time.
步骤S502,对所述商品信息进行特征编码,以得到所述待结算商品的特征。Step S502, feature encoding the product information to obtain the feature of the commodity to be settled.
在本发明的示例性实施例中,步骤S502包括:通过多个深度神经网络分别对所述商品信息进行特征编码,以得到多个编码结果;将所述多个编码结果进行拼接,以得到所述待结算商品的特征。In an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, step S502 includes: separately encoding the commodity information by using a plurality of depth neural networks to obtain a plurality of encoding results; and splicing the plurality of encoding results to obtain a Describe the characteristics of the settled item.
具体地,步骤S501的检测结果为包含待结算商品的矩形框,因此步骤S502的目的是对处于该矩形框内的图像信息进行特征编码。可选地,可以对softmax loss和triplet loss这两种神经网络模型进行训练,然后基于训练结果来对商品信息进行特征编码。当然,本发明的实施例并不限于此,还可以采用其他的神经网络模型。Specifically, the detection result of step S501 is a rectangular frame including the item to be settled, so the purpose of step S502 is to feature-encode the image information in the rectangular frame. Alternatively, the two neural network models, softmax loss and triplet loss, can be trained, and then the commodity information is feature-coded based on the training result. Of course, embodiments of the invention are not limited thereto, and other neural network models may also be employed.
步骤S503,将所述待结算商品的特征与预存储的特征进行比对,以确定所述待结算商品的种类。Step S503, comparing the feature of the commodity to be settled with the pre-stored feature to determine the type of the commodity to be settled.
在本发明的示例性实施例中,步骤S503包括:计算所述待结算商品的特征与预存储的特征之间的距离;将预存储的特征中与所述待结算商品的特征之间的距离小于预定阈值 的特征作为匹配到的目标特征;将所述目标特征对应的商品种类作为所述待结算商品的种类。In an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, step S503 includes: calculating a distance between a feature of the item to be settled and a pre-stored feature; and a distance between a feature of the pre-stored feature and a feature of the item to be settled A feature that is less than a predetermined threshold is used as the matched target feature; the product category corresponding to the target feature is used as the type of the commodity to be settled.
需要说明的是,待结算商品的种类可以通过SKU(Stock Keeping Unit,库存量单位,现在已经被引申为产品统一编号的简称,每种产品均对应有唯一的SKU号)来进行标识。如果没有匹配到目标特征,则算法返回空。It should be noted that the type of goods to be settled may be identified by a SKU (Stock Keeping Unit, which has been extended to the abbreviation of the product uniform number, and each product has a unique SKU number). If there is no match to the target feature, the algorithm returns null.
继续参照图4所示,所示的自助结算方法还包括:Continuing to refer to FIG. 4, the self-service settlement method shown further includes:
步骤S404,若所述待结算商品是所述目标类型的商品,则识别所述待结算商品的数量并获取所述待结算商品的单价,根据所述待结算商品的数量和单价生成结算信息。Step S404: If the item to be settled is the item of the target type, identify the quantity of the item to be settled and obtain the unit price of the item to be settled, and generate settlement information according to the quantity and unit price of the item to be settled.
在本发明的实施例中,可以通过图像采集设备,如摄像头来识别待结算商品的数量。而待结算商品的单价可以根据识别到的商品信息来确定。In an embodiment of the invention, the number of items to be settled may be identified by an image capture device, such as a camera. The unit price of the goods to be settled can be determined based on the identified product information.
步骤S406,若所述待结算商品不是所述目标类型的商品,则识别所述待结算商品的种类并获取所述待结算商品的重量,根据所述待结算商品的种类和重量生成结算信息。Step S406: If the item to be settled is not the item of the target type, identify the type of the item to be settled and obtain the weight of the item to be settled, and generate settlement information according to the type and weight of the item to be settled.
在本发明的实施例中,当生成结算信息之后,可以输出结算信息。如通过显示设备显示该结算信息,和/或通过音频播放设备播放该结算信息。当然,还可以将该结算信息发送至指定的设备,比如用户的手机中。In an embodiment of the present invention, after the settlement information is generated, the settlement information may be output. The settlement information is displayed, for example, by the display device, and/or played by the audio playback device. Of course, the settlement information can also be sent to a designated device, such as a user's mobile phone.
基于上述实施例中的自助结算设备与自助结算方法,以下介绍本发明的一个具体应用场景:Based on the self-checkout device and the self-service settlement method in the above embodiments, a specific application scenario of the present invention is described below:
a、顾客将商品放置于结算台上的识别区域。a. The customer places the item in the identification area on the settlement counter.
b、称重台在重量稳定后,获得重量信息,并触发图像采集设备采集商品的图像信息。b. After the weight is stabilized, the weighing platform obtains the weight information and triggers the image collecting device to collect the image information of the commodity.
c、设置在不同位置处的图像采集设备将采集到的图像信息上传到后台进行算法处理,并返回识别出的商品SKU。c. The image collection device set at different positions uploads the collected image information to the background for algorithm processing, and returns the identified product SKU.
d、后台同时接受RFID(Radio Frequency Identification,射频识别)阅读器的识别结果。d. The background also accepts the recognition result of RFID (Radio Frequency Identification) reader.
e、如果RFID有结果,则可以直接在显示器上显示出所购买商品。如果对图像处理的算法返回结果(即返回商品的SKU),则区分该SKU是标准品还是非标准品:若是标准品,则根据算法结果返回SKU数量,以通过数量和单价进行结算;若是非标准品,则根据重量信息进行结算。e. If the RFID has a result, the purchased item can be displayed directly on the display. If the algorithm for image processing returns a result (ie, returns the SKU of the item), then distinguish whether the SKU is a standard product or a non-standard product: if it is a standard product, the number of SKUs is returned according to the algorithm result, and is settled by quantity and unit price; Standard products are settled based on weight information.
f、如果顾客不放置商品,而是直接用扫码枪进行扫码识别,则直接进行扫码识别结算。f. If the customer does not place the product, but directly scans the code with the scan code gun, the scan code identification settlement is directly performed.
本发明上述实施例的自助结算方法中提出的图像处理方案对商品的识别速度快,识别率高。同时,本发明实施例中的自助结算方法支持标准品和非标准品的识别结算,并且支持RFID、条形码、图像识别结算,适用范围广,有利于提升用户的结算体验。The image processing scheme proposed in the self-checkout method of the above embodiment of the present invention has a fast recognition speed for goods and a high recognition rate. At the same time, the self-settlement method in the embodiment of the present invention supports the identification and settlement of standard products and non-standard products, and supports RFID, barcode, image recognition and settlement, and has wide application range, which is beneficial to improving the settlement experience of users.
